The two producers: one's Pluto, one's Venus

Article Abstract:

Atlantis chairman Michael McMillan will head the new entity called Alliance Atlantis following a merger between Alliance Communications and Atlantis. As as result. Atlantis will be transformed into the 12th largest film and TV studio in North America with combined revenues of C$597 million and assets of C$850 million for 1998. Alliance is the largest Canadian film and TV company with 1998 revenues of C$386 million. Alliance's head Robert Lantos reportedly wanted out because he was getting to an age and level of responsibility that was tiresome and may return to producing films financed by the new firm for at least three years.

Lindsey Morden to buy Ellis & Buckle

Article Abstract:

Lindsey Morden Group Inc. of Toronto, Ontario, is acquiring London UK-based Ellis and Buckle from Rutland Trust PLC for $153.6 million. The acquisition of Ellis and Buckle, which offers insurance claims management and loss management services, allows Lindsey Morden to expand anew its British presence. Lindsey Morden will pay 15 million pounds sterling of the purchase price using Lindsey Morden subordinate voting shares priced at $20 per share, while the rest will be paid in cash or unsecured notes. The transaction is expected to be completed by November 1998, pending approval by regulators and Rutland's shareholders.
